Principal Scientist I, Structural Biologics Job ID REQ-10033660 USA Summary Position is onsite in San Diego, CA. The Biologics Research Center, Structural Biologics department is looking for a highly motivated Senior Scientist to support experimental structural biology across multiple biotherapeutic programs.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ience in all aspects of the gene to structure pipeline including the acquisition and interpretation of structural biology data from X-ray crystallography and/or CryoEM. The candidate will be part of multidisciplinary teams that support early to late stage biotherapeutic drug discovery programs by providing structural data and protein engineering support. They will use their experience in the gene-to-structure pipeline to address the challenges of high-resolution structure determination to support the design of novel biotherapeutics capable of addressing the next generation of biomedical applications. About the Role Your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Design, troubleshooting and execution of experiments to determine the structure of multi-protein complexes by X-ray crystallography or CryoEM with an aim to support the design and development of novel biotherapeutics. Working closely across experimental and computational groups to address key scientific questions. Communication of results to multidisciplinary teams across the larger Novartis research organization. Prioritization, coordination and efficient time management of experimental deliverables. Mentor junior scientists, fostering a culture of innovation, collaboration, and scientific excellence. Contribute to overall strategy in the structural biology group. Awareness of the external technology landscape and its application to biotherapeutic drug development. Participation as structural biology representative on drug discovery and technology project teams, contributing to overall project strategy with accountability within the project for own area of expertise. What you’ll bring to the role as a Principal Investigator I: PhD degree in biophysics, biochemistry, or related discipline with a proven record in experimental structural biology. Minimum 5 years’ experience in common protein purification methods (Affinity, IMAC, SEC) and molecular biology techniques (cloning, DNA isolation, transformation, etc.) Demonstrated independent thought/creativity in science with attention to details. Proven ability in structural biology methods (either X-ray crystallography and or CryoEM, both preferred) including protein crystallization, crystal optimization, CryoEM sample and grid preparation, data acquisition, map generation and structure solution. Demonstrated problem-solving capability for challenging structural biology projects, with expertise in developing protocols for dealing with novel protein targets. High degree of self-motivation and attention to detail. Strong organizational and time management skills. Desire to learn/operate across numerous functions (expression, purification, analytics, structural biology, and computational modelling). Desired Requirements: Experience with using AI-based techniques to facilitate protein construct design, engineering and protein structure prediction is preferred. Familiarity with analytical and biophysical methods (light scattering, ITC, DSC, LCMS, anSEC, etc.) and laboratory automation is highly desirable.
